If you'd like to instal the Hollywood TV series set of the "Lost in Space" crash site for FS 9, look for it at the larger sim sites. It's a great little add on with lots of options. It is located, as was the original set, near the Torna Pinacles out near the Mohave Desert.

Search for: j2crashsitefs9.zip
